3. Power down the host PC. If you are using a remote controller, Shut Down the PC BEFORE you power down the chas- sis. When you restore power, power up the chassis BEFORE you power up the PC. Agilent M9302A PXI Local Oscillator Startup Guide...
4. Before inserting the module into the chassis, back the mounting screws out to ensure that there is no inter- ference between the screws and the mounting rails. 5. Holding the module by the injector/ejector handle, slide it into an available PXI (or hybrid) slot, as shown in the figure below. Agilent M9302A PXI Local Oscillator Startup Guide...

Requirements for Operational Check The Agilent M9302A PXI Local Oscillator operational check measures the LO OUT signal and uses that as a ref- erence to compare the signal paths to the 10 MHz REF OUT and the two 100 MHz REF OUT connectors. The fol- lowing process demonstrates that all associated connectors, cables and circuitry are operational.
